Description from the seller
This neat Mercedes-Benz 380 SL from 1982 runs well and has attracted a lot of attention recently. It is an absolute classic that draws a lot of admiring glances. The Mercedes-Benz R107 is one of the most iconic and longest-produced model ranges of the German luxury car brand. This 'Sport Leicht' (SL) roadster was built between 1971 and 1989 and is worldwide known for its unmatched build quality, timeless elegance, and comfortable driving characteristics.
BODYWORK & PAINT
The body is in good condition and shows no rust spots. The chrome is also in very good condition. The soft top is still in good condition and does not leak. The hardtop is also in top condition. Some rubber seals are due for replacement. There have been small repairs to the body here and there. The body is solid and does not require welding. The paint shows no major damage and is tight. Light stone chips are present.
TECHNICAL
The tires and brakes have been replaced, all filters and oil have also been replaced. All functions in the car work except the air conditioning. Occasionally the cruise control hesitates. Furthermore the engine runs very nicely and starts reliably in warm or cold conditions. The Mercedes rides smoothly on the road and makes no strange noises while driving. The 4-speed automatic transmission shifts well through all gears.
INTERIOR
The upholstery of the interior is still in very nice condition. The leather shows no damage and is still in absolute top condition. The wooden parts show light signs of use. The interior lighting, radio and all gauges in the instrument panel work properly.
DOCUMENTS
The Mercedes is currently registered with a valid Dutch license plate. There is obviously the possibility to make export papers for registration in another country. All original stickers are still in the door and there is also documentation from America and proof of paid import duties still available.
The car can be picked up in Heerenveen, Netherlands. It can also be shipped from this location.
